Hello. I am having a problem with my display, I have gtx 650 ti boost and when i upgraded the driver to 314.22 my tv only displays invalid format. I tried reinstalling the old driver but there's no difference. I also tried installing in safe mode. Please help!

I read on similar issues and I learned that "invalid format" means the tv cannot handle the resolution. My question now is how do I access the nvidia control panel to change the resolution? I tried it in safe mode but i cant access it there. hope someone can help me :(
